There comes a point in every students life where they have to decide on what path they’re going to take concerning the future of their education. Science, Art or Commercial?

For as long as I’ve been on this earth, there’s always been an unending argument centred on which department is the best. Undue importance has been placed on the Science department. It has been glorified to some kind ultimate department which I think ought not to be.

When I had just graduated from the JSS Three class in secondary school and was on the brink of entering into the SSS One class, I had to make a decision on what department I wanted to belong to. I chose the art department which surprised everyone but myself.

I got questioned a lot about my choice of department. Oh, science is for intelligent people, You shouldn’t be in the art department, you’re qualified to be a science student blah blah blah. Some of my classmates were even surprised that I had chosen the art department. My parents didn’t really care what department I had chosen so long as I was getting an education. But other people felt the need to interfere in my choice. Some teachers tried to change my mind. One teacher even went as far as calling my parents to convince me to change my mind.

Oh, I’m sorry that I’m not interested in formulas and mixing chemicals(insert eye roll). I don’t want to be a doctor, nurse, engineer, scientist or any career science related so tell me why I should be in the science department.

The point is majority of the people believed that Science class was for the intelligent ones and the other departments were meant for the less intelligent ones because apparently the Science department is tougher than the rest. Oh, please. Every department has its own hurdles, no one has it that easy.

No department is better than the other in my opinion, they’re all different. You don’t have to be in a particular department because you’re “intelligent”. You being in the science department doesn’t mean you’re intelligent and you being in any other department doesn’t mean you’re not intelligent. You should only be in the department in which you want to be, end of story.

It’s also annoying how the science students believe that they’re better than the other students. Really, really, really annoying.

You don’t need to look down on a person based on what department they belong to.

So my dear, you can be whoever you want to be and be in whatever department is best for you and matches your passion or interests.
